SEC :
Secchi depth
|
|
Satellite
|
SEASTAR
|
|
Instrument
|
SeaWiFS
|
|
Algorithm
|
SEC-JC1
|
|
Description
|
Secchi depth in the German Bight derived from SeaWiFS data taken on 3-Aug-2004. The artifacts in the southern parts of the image are caused by instrumental noise.

SST :
Sea surface temperature
|
|
Satellite
|
NOAA17
|
|
Instrument
|
AVHRR
|
|
Algorithm
|
SST-GG2
|
|
Description
|
Sea surface temperature of the Northern Adriatic Sea derived from AVHRR onboard NOAA 17 taken on 30-May-2005. Apparently cooler temperatures close to the Italian coast are probably caused by unidentified thin clouds.

TSM :
Total suspended matter
|
|
Satellite
|
SEASTAR
|
|
Instrument
|
SeaWiFS
|
|
Algorithm
|
TSM-FA3
|
|
Description
|
Total suspended matter concentration in the Southern North Sea derived from SeaWiFS data taken on 17-Aug-2002. Very high concentrations are observed in the river Thames estuary.

MAR :
Marine reflectance at 550nm
|
|
Satellite
|
SEASTAR
|
|
Instrument
|
SeaWiFS
|
|
Algorithm
|
MAR-XG1
|
|
Description
|
Marine (subsurface) reflectance at 550 nm in the Southern North Sea derived from SeaWiFS data taken on 17-Aug-2002. High values indicate high concentrations of total suspended matter (TSM).
